NIO Inc. reported Q2 2026 results with strong year-over-year growth but missed both vehicle delivery and revenue guidance. Margins improved significantly versus last year, though sequential declines reflected cost pressures, particularly higher lithium prices. NIO's Q3 guidance disappointed, projecting minimal sequential delivery growth and revenues well below street expectations.
NIO Inc (NYSE:NIO) shares fell after the Chinese electric vehicle maker posted second-quarter revenue that missed Wall Street expectations, even as the company narrowed its losses and pointed to improving margins. Revenue rose 69.1% year-over-year to RMB32.14 billion ($4.74 billion), falling short of the roughly $4.95 billion analysts had expected.
NIO NYSE: NIO reported second-quarter 2026 vehicle deliveries of 107,658, up 49.4% from a year earlier, as revenue rose 69.1% to RMB32.1 billion and the company narrowed its operating and net losses.

NIO Inc., originating as NextEV Inc., transitioned its brand name in July 2017 to establish itself firmly within the electric vehicle sector. Established in 2014 and based in Shanghai, China, NIO has rapidly emerged as a frontrunner in the design, development, manufacturing, and sales of smart electric vehicles. With a focused market presence in China, NIO Inc. seeks to redefine the automotive experience by integrating advanced technological solutions and user-centric services with their line of electric vehicles, addressing the growing global demand for sustainable and intelligent transportation options.
NIO's product lineup includes high-performance, luxury five and six-seater electric SUVs alongside cutting-edge smart electric sedans. These vehicles are designed with a focus on comfort, safety, and efficiency, catering to the needs of modern families and individuals seeking eco-friendly transportation options.
